What is a Personalized Mental Health Assessment?
[Personalized mental health assessments](https://www.vallieharrigill.top/health/private-healthcare-mental-health-for-a-brighter-tomorrow/) are tailored evaluations that gather comprehensive information about a person's mental and psychological well-being. Unlike standardized assessments that apply a one-size-fits-all method, personalized assessments concentrate on the customer's distinct experiences and challenges. These assessments can include a variety of tools and methods, such as questionnaires, interviews, and observational assessments.

The process of performing a personalized mental health assessment normally involves a number of key actions. Below is a breakdown of these steps:
1. Preliminary Consultation
Throughout the initial consultation, the mental health expert gathers preliminary details through open-ended questions. This conversation is crucial for constructing relationship and trust, which helps with deeper conversations.
2. Comprehensive History Taking
This step includes gathering detailed info about the person's:
Psychological History: Previous mental health medical diagnoses, treatment history, and household history of mental disease.Physical Health: Medical conditions, medication usage, and way of life aspects.Social Environment: Relationships, work-life balance, and stressors or trauma experienced.3. Standardized Tools and Questionnaires
Utilizing standardized tools can assist quantify mental health symptoms and facilitate comparisons. Some popular tools consist of:
Beck Depression Inventory (BDI)Generalized Anxiety Disorder 7 (GAD-7)Patient Health Questionnaire-9 (PHQ-9)
While these assessments provide important insights, they need to not eclipse the personalized technique.
4. Observational Assessment
Observations throughout sessions can provide valuable context that numbers and histories might not record. Mental health experts evaluate non-verbal cues, psychological actions, and behavioral patterns.
5. Collective Goal Setting
When the data is gathered, the mental health expert collaborates with the private to set particular goals. This empowers customers to take ownership of their mental health journey.
Future Trends in Personalized Mental Health Assessments
With developments in innovation and increased awareness about mental health, numerous patterns are emerging in personalized assessments.
1. Digital Tools
The increase of teletherapy and mental health apps is providing opportunities for real-time assessments and interventions. Digital platforms can gather information continually, providing a more comprehensive photo of a person's mental wellness.
2. Expert system
As expert system (AI) continues to establish, its application in mental health assessments is becoming more substantial. AI can examine huge quantities of data rapidly, recognizing patterns that may not be obvious to human clinicians.
3. Combination of Genetics
Emerging research recommends that genetics may influence mental health. Incorporating hereditary testing into personalized assessments could pave the method for more targeted interventions customized to a person's genetic dangers.
4. Interdisciplinary Collaboration
The future of mental health assessments may involve collaborative techniques that integrate insights from different disciplines, such as social work, psychology, psychiatry, and nutrition.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How do I know if I require a mental health assessment?
A: If you're experiencing consistent state of mind modifications, anxiety, problem in functioning at work or in social circumstances, or have a family history of mental disorder, it might be beneficial to seek a mental health assessment.
Q2: Are personalized assessments more accurate than standardized tests?
A: While personalized assessments offer a holistic view of an individual's mental health, standardized tests provide particular measures of signs. The precision often depends upon the individual and their requirements, making a combination of both useful.
Q3: How long does a personalized mental health assessment take?
A: The duration of an assessment can differ, however it generally lasts between one to two hours, followed by additional time for follow-ups and objective setting.
Q4: Can personalized assessments be performed online?
A: Yes, numerous mental health professionals provide virtual assessments through safe and secure online platforms, making them accessible and convenient for customers.
Q5: What should I expect during a personalized mental health assessment?
A: Expect a series of questions covering numerous aspects of your mental health, emotions, and life circumstances. The assessment process is collective, allowing you to reveal your concerns and experiences freely.
